Jenifer Harris is a seasoned marketing and communications professional with extensive experience in the healthcare sector. Currently serving as the Senior Manager of Marketing Communications at ChristianaCare since December 2021, Jenifer has successfully led marketing efforts across Delaware, Maryland, and Pennsylvania, managing a $1.5M budget and achieving significant growth milestones, including exceeding enrollment goals and launching new services. Previously, as the Director of Communications & Public Affairs at MaineHealth from August 2014 to December 2021, Jenifer oversaw internal communications and led COVID-19 communications, enhancing community outreach and introducing new services. Earlier roles include Director of Marketing & External Affairs at Saint Francis Healthcare, where Jenifer implemented marketing strategies that significantly increased public awareness and operational efficiency, and Director of Marketing & Community Affairs at the Delaware Symphony Orchestra, where Jenifer achieved notable increases in attendance and media coverage. Jenifer holds an MBA and a BA in History/Political Science from Chatham University.

ChristianaCare, head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ware, is one of the country’s largest health care providers, ranking 22nd in the nation for hospital admissions. ChristianaCare is a major teaching hospital with two campuses and more than 250 Medical-Dental residents and fellows. ChristianaCare is recognized as a regional center for excellence in cardiology, cancer and women’s health services. The system is home to Delaware’s only Level I trauma center for adults and children, the only center of its kind between Philadelphia and Baltimore. ChristianaCare also features a Level III neonatal intensive care unit, the only delivering hospital in the state to offer this level of care for newborns. A not-for-profit, non-sectarian health system, ChristianaCare includes two hospitals with more than 1,100 patient beds, a home health care service, preventive medicine, rehabilitation services, a network of primary care physicians and an extensive range of outpatient services. With more than 11,600 employees, ChristianaCare is the largest private employer in Delaware and among the top 10 in the Philadelphia region. Statistics at a Glance: Among hospitals in the United States, ChristianaCare’s ranking by volume is: 22nd in admissions. 32nd in births. 24th in emergency visits. 32nd in total surgeries. Among hospitals on the East Coast, ChristianaCare ranks: 12th in admissions. 16th in births. 15th in emergency visits. 19th in total surgeries. (Source: American Hospital Association Annual Survey Database of 6,200 U.S. Hospitals, 2017, © Health Forum, LLC) Awards: Christiana Care is continually recognized for excellence on a regional and national level.
